I read it on one of the IGN Blog pages.  I think maybe Bozon's or Peer's.

It was an old Gameboy Pac Man game, but it had a verse mode where when you ate the ghosts it sent them to the other players boards.

Now imagine you have a game like that that supported 4 player Pac Man action.  With 4 players when you eat one of the 4 ghosts each is sent to a different players board...still allowing a potential total of 8 ghosts against one person.  Anyway, I think this is a great VS mode idea that needs to be created again and explored again.

Post by: UncleBob on June 20, 2007, 07:15:23 AM
The "game" ends when one player is caught by the Ghosts three times (although you can earn extra lives by points).  On the Game Over screen, it shows both player's scores and declares one player the winner.  Unfortunatly, I'm not certian how this is decided since each match we played, my friend would have the lower score and would be killed first.

Anywhoo, in his particular situation, if he could manage to complete the maze (by eating all the dots, of course), he would be rewarded with a new maze (with new Power Pellets to send Ghosts back to me).  However, with 8 Ghosts and no Power Pellets in his current maze, it'd be quite the challage to finish...
